LR3 - what do we know?
i work on them for a living... they use the same jaguar v8 engine as the XJ8, XK and XF.
the transmission is a ZF 6 speed; bmw, audi , jaguar use the same one. the drivetrain is pretty bulletproof. the problems arise from electrical issues, stupid interior trim issues and basically just random stupid problems. they don't have consistent problems across the model range that always occur; everything is different. to me, that's worse than having one or 2 of the same problems that happen to every car. they do go through brakes very often, just because it's a heavy truck.
